'Heparin ointment'. Application, side effects and overdose

To reduce the risk of blood clots, as well as to effectively dissolve existing foci during operations in medicine, substances called anticoagulants are widely used. One of the representatives of such a saving substance is "Heparin", it is used for preventive and curative purposes. This substance helps to get rid of thrombophlebitis, thrombosis, thromboembolism, as well as arising thromboembolic complications.

"Heparin ointment" is a combined preparation intended for external use. It includes heparin, benzilnicotinate and benzocaine. The main substance of this drug is gradually separated from other components and has a moderate anti-inflammatory and antithrombic effect. It also provides a reduction in the volume of blood clots and their complete disappearance, and also prevents the formation of new ones. The benzocaine included in this product has a local anesthetic effect and softens the pain. The action of benzyl nicotinate is to expand the surface blood vessels and improve the absorption of the main active substance.

"Heparin ointment" is used for lesions of extremities, which are a consequence of thrombophlebitis and thrombosis. This drug also has an effective effect on damage to veins caused by hemorrhoids.

"Heparin ointment". Indications for use.

This tool is used for the following ailments:

- formation of thrombi,

- inflammatory processes in the venous walls,

- hematomas due to injuries,

- stretching, sprains,

- edema, sports injuries,

- inflammation of the veins after injection.

The amount of the drug taken is regulated depending on the individual situation. It is especially important to take into account the general state of human health .

"Heparin ointment". Contraindications.

- processes of ulcerative-necrotic nature, occurring in the area affected by thrombophlebitis,

- violations of the process of blood coagulation ,

- decrease in the number of platelets - thrombocytopenia,

- Hypersensitivity to the components of the drug.

This tool is not recommended for application to open wounds, from which pus is released. During the period of gestation, the "heparin ointment" from varicose can be used only for the purpose of the specialist and under his supervision. During the period of breastfeeding, the use of this drug will not harm either the mother or the baby, but in this case it is better to consult with the doctor before using.

How to use this tool correctly?

"Heparin ointment" from bruises is applied with neat massaging movements to the affected area several times a day. When treating a bruise or tumor, this drug is not recommended for more than ten days, and for inflammation in the superficial veins - from one to two weeks. To get rid of hemorrhoidal thrombosis this remedy is applied rectally. It is used daily until the symptoms disappear. A significant improvement in the condition occurs on average in three to fourteen days.

Side effects and signs of an overdose.

Symptom of exceeding the dose of "Heparin" may be bleeding. In this case, you need to immediately seek medical help from a specialist. Side effects of the application of this ointment can be urticaria, dermatitis, skin itching. Before using this drug, it is recommended to apply it in a thin layer on a small area of the skin. In the absence of a negative reaction in a day, you can start using this ointment.
